Sunday, January 15, 1967

Paul McCartney and George Harrison attend a concert by Donovan

On this day, Paul McCartney and George Harrison attended a live concert by Donovan at the Royal Albert Hall. They saw him perform again, this time joined by the other two Beatles, on April 24, 1967. Other notable attendees included Julie Felix, Marianne Faithfull, Brian Epstein, the Small Faces, and Stevie Winwood.
